]> git.zerfleddert.de Git - proxmark3-svn/blobdiff - client/cmdlfem4x.h
Merge pull request #90 from 4m4rOk/master
[proxmark3-svn] / client / cmdlfem4x.h
index 38f9aab9128a48e1758ba3a79e46a2926c3be90f..797f5d1ebf16d0ff42c3aaa55288bf7a875a29b0 100644 (file)
 #ifndef CMDLFEM4X_H__
 #define CMDLFEM4X_H__
 
-int CmdLFEM4X(const char *Cmd);
+#include <stdio.h>
+#include <string.h>
+#include <inttypes.h>
+#include "proxmark3.h"
+#include "ui.h"
+#include "util.h"
+#include "graph.h"
+#include "cmdparser.h"
+#include "cmddata.h"
+#include "cmdmain.h"
+#include "cmdmain.h"
+#include "cmdlf.h"
+#include "lfdemod.h"
+
 int CmdEMdemodASK(const char *Cmd);
 int CmdEM410xRead(const char *Cmd);
 int CmdEM410xSim(const char *Cmd);
@@ -19,10 +32,15 @@ int CmdEM410xWatch(const char *Cmd);
 int CmdEM410xWatchnSpoof(const char *Cmd);
 int CmdEM410xWrite(const char *Cmd);
 int CmdEM4x50Read(const char *Cmd);
+int CmdLFEM4X(const char *Cmd);
 int CmdReadWord(const char *Cmd);
-int CmdReadWordPWD(const char *Cmd);
 int CmdWriteWord(const char *Cmd);
-int CmdWriteWordPWD(const char *Cmd);
-int MWRem4xReplay(const char* Cmd);
+int EM4x50Read(const char *Cmd, bool verbose);
+
+bool EM4x05IsBlock0(uint32_t *word);
+
+int usage_lf_em410x_sim(void);
+int usage_lf_em_read(void);
+int usage_lf_em_write(void);
 
 #endif
Impressum, Datenschutz